			<content type="html"><![CDATA[<p>The video is at a kinda weird angle but toward the end I think I saw the problem. Correct me if I&#039;m wrong, but you&#039;re printing a skirt and then when it starts to print the model, it overlaps onto the skirt?</p><p>If so, check the model you&#039;re trying to print. Specifically check to make sure it&#039;s lying completely flat against the bed before you print. If you&#039;re using RH or OctoPi check the preview G-code starting at Layer 1, if everything looks ok, check the next layer to see when in the G-code it starts to overlap the skirt. This will let you know if it&#039;s a problem with the model. </p><p>The skirt is in yellow and the model is in red.<br /><span class="postimg"><img src="http://soliforum.com/i/?FH2YIDC.jpg" alt="http://soliforum.com/i/?FH2YIDC.jpg" /></span></p>]]></content>
